jQuery获取元素CSS属性的实现方法

引言

在前端开发中,我们经常需要获取元素的CSS属性来实现一些动态效果或者操作。jQuery是一个流行的JavaScript库,它提供了一种简单的方法来获取元素的CSS属性。本篇文章将教会你如何使用jQuery来获取元素的CSS属性,帮助你更好地理解和掌握这个技巧。

整体流程

下面是获取元素CSS属性的整体流程,我们可以通过一个表格来展示这些步骤:

步骤 描述
步骤1 引入jQuery库
步骤2 选择目标元素
步骤3 获取元素CSS属性

接下来,我们将逐步详细说明每个步骤需要做什么,并提供相应的代码。

步骤1:引入jQuery库

在使用jQuery之前,我们需要先引入jQuery库。你可以通过以下方式引入:

<script src="

这段代码将会在你的HTML文件中引入jQuery库。

步骤2:选择目标元素

在使用jQuery获取元素CSS属性之前,我们需要先选择目标元素。你可以使用选择器来选择元素。以下是一些常见的选择器:

  • 元素选择器:选择指定的HTML元素,例如 $("div") 选择所有的 <div> 元素。
  • ID选择器:选择指定ID的元素,例如 $("#myDiv") 选择 id 为 "myDiv" 的元素。
  • 类选择器:选择指定类名的元素,例如 $(".myClass") 选择所有类名为 "myClass" 的元素。

例如,我们要选择一个 id 为 "myDiv" 的元素,你可以使用以下代码:

var targetElement = $("#myDiv");

步骤3:获取元素CSS属性

一旦选择了目标元素,我们可以使用jQuery提供的方法来获取元素的CSS属性。以下是一些常用的方法:

  • css():获取指定CSS属性的值。
  • height():获取元素的高度。
  • width():获取元素的宽度。

例如,我们要获取元素的宽度和高度,你可以使用以下代码:

var width = targetElement.width(); // 获取元素的宽度
var height = targetElement.height(); // 获取元素的高度

你也可以获取指定CSS属性的值。例如,我们要获取元素的背景颜色,你可以使用以下代码:

var backgroundColor = targetElement.css("background-color"); // 获取元素的背景颜色

完整示例

下面是一个完整的示例代码,演示了如何使用jQuery获取元素CSS属性:

<!DOCTYPE html>
<html>
<head>
  <script src="
</head>
<body>
  <div id="myDiv" class="myClass" style="width: 200px; height: 100px; background-color: red;"></div>

  <script>
    var targetElement = $("#myDiv");
    var width = targetElement.width(); // 获取元素的宽度
    var height = targetElement.height(); // 获取元素的高度
    var backgroundColor = targetElement.css("background-color"); // 获取元素的背景颜色

    console.log("宽度:" + width);
    console.log("高度:" + height);
    console.log("背景颜色:" + backgroundColor);
  </script>
</body>
</html>

运行以上代码,你将看到控制台输出了元素的宽度、高度和背景颜色。

总结

通过本文的介绍,你应该已经了解了如何使用jQuery来获取元素的CSS属性。首先,我们需要引入jQuery库;然后,选择目标元素;最后,使用相应的方法获取元素的CSS属性。希望本文能够帮助你更好地掌握这个技巧,提升你的前端开发能力!